A serving of Onion Rings Fast Foods (117g) contains 29.5g of fat, which is 38% of the recommended daily value based on a 2,000 calorie diet.
Dietary fat is essential for energy, nutrient absorption, and hormone production. Focus on healthy unsaturated fats. When planning your meals, consider that onion rings fast foods is a significant source of fat compared to other proteins.
